Asensin FreeBSD 5.2.1 ja hakemistorakenne vaikuttaa vähän oudolta verrattuna vanhoihin versioihin ja Linuxiin.
1. Ensin miksi juuressa on niin paljon hakemistoja?
# ls /
.cshrc
.profile
boot
dist
lib
rescue
sys
cdrom
entropy
libexec
root
tmp
.snap
compat
etc
mnt
sbin
usr
bin
dev
home
proc
stand
var
2. Mitä tekevät juuressa .cshrc ja .profile ? Eikö ne pitäisi olla jokaisen käyttäjät kotihakemistossa?
3. Mitä nämä ovat ?
lrwxr-xr-x 1 root wheel 10 Mar 6 19:30 compat -> usr/compat
-rw------- 1 root wheel 4096 Mar 6 20:44 entropy
drwxr-xr-x 2 root wheel 2560 Mar 6 19:26 rescue
drwxr-xr-x 4 root wheel 1024 Mar 6 19:26 stand
lrwxrwxrwx 1 root wheel 11 Mar 6 19:27 sys -> usr/src/sys
4. Miksi tuo /sys ei edes toimi?
# cd /sys
/sys: No such file or directory.
# cd /usr/src/sys
/usr/src/sys: No such file or directory.
Oudot hakemistot...
5
672
Vastaukset
- tunppi
Ehkä joku paketin purku on menny himpun verran phituiks, uskoisin...
- Mik
1. Niitä on noin paljon varmaan siitä yksinkertaisesta syystä, että niille on jotain tarvetta.
2. Juuren .cshrc ja .profile ovat varmaankin rootin käyttämiä, koska rootin kotihakemisto taitaa olla BSD:ssä yleensä / (veikkaus).
3. Jotain BSD-spesifisiä hakemistoja/tiedostoja, olettaisin.
4.Koska hakemistoa /usr/src/sys ei ole olemassa, niin /sys-linkkikään ei tietenkään toimi.- FreeBSD
1. Ja voinko kysyä mikä tarve? Ainakin ne eivät ole dokumentoitu: http://www.freebsd.org/doc/en_US.ISO8859-1/books/handbook/dirstructure.html
2. Kuten näet siinä on myös /root hakemisto, ja nämä tiedostot ovat myös /root hakemistossa:
# ls /root
.cshrc .k5login mbox
.history .login .profile
3/4 Ja miksi se teki tämän linkin kun ei ole sellaista hakemistoakaan mihin se viittaisi?
Asensin uudelleen, ja samat hakemistot ja tiedostot ovat edelleen siinä. - Mik
FreeBSD kirjoitti:
1. Ja voinko kysyä mikä tarve? Ainakin ne eivät ole dokumentoitu: http://www.freebsd.org/doc/en_US.ISO8859-1/books/handbook/dirstructure.html
2. Kuten näet siinä on myös /root hakemisto, ja nämä tiedostot ovat myös /root hakemistossa:
# ls /root
.cshrc .k5login mbox
.history .login .profile
3/4 Ja miksi se teki tämän linkin kun ei ole sellaista hakemistoakaan mihin se viittaisi?
Asensin uudelleen, ja samat hakemistot ja tiedostot ovat edelleen siinä.Niinno .. vastasinpahan kysymyksiisi, vaikken olekaan käyttänyt *BSD:tä. 1. kohdan linkistä löytyi linkki hier(7):n manuaalisivuun, jolla näyttää olevan kuvattu joidenkin puuttuvien hakemistojen kuvauksia. Muihin kohtiin en osaa sanoa sen kummempaa suoralta kädeltä.
- cappu
Mik kirjoitti:
Niinno .. vastasinpahan kysymyksiisi, vaikken olekaan käyttänyt *BSD:tä. 1. kohdan linkistä löytyi linkki hier(7):n manuaalisivuun, jolla näyttää olevan kuvattu joidenkin puuttuvien hakemistojen kuvauksia. Muihin kohtiin en osaa sanoa sen kummempaa suoralta kädeltä.
jos /usr/src/sys hakemistoa ei löydy se tarkoittaa sitä että et ole asennuksessa ottanut mukaan kernelin lähdekoodeja. ne saa jälkikäteen asennettua sysinstall komennolla. (Configure -> Distributions -> src) josta ota mukaan base ja sys.
Ketjusta on poistettu 0 sääntöjenvastaista viestiä.
Luetuimmat keskustelut
- 1017503
Siekkilässä ajettu ihmisten yli- mitä tapahtui? Länsi-Savo ei ole uutisoinut asiata
Manneja, vaiko matuja?935310- 834977
- 1364354
Alavuden sairaala
Säästääkö Alavuden sairaala sähkössä. Kävin Sunnuntaina vast. otolla. Odotushuone ja käytävä jolla lääkäri otti vastaan113110- 522739
- 462732
- 552322
Törkeää toimintaa
Todella törkeitä kaheleita niitä on Ylivieskassakin. https://www.ess.fi/uutissuomalainen/8570818112299Suudeltiin unessa viime yönä
Oltiin jossain rannalla jonkun avolava auton lavalla, jossa oli patja ja peitto. Uni päättyi, kun kömmit viereeni tähtit211890